🔐 【Encryption Evening News】2026.08.19
• Spot Bitcoin ETFs saw a net inflow of $189 million in a single day, with August totals possibly breaking $1 billion
Funds are flowing back faster; institutional allocation demand supports a period of stabilization【mkt】
• BlackRock: BTC has already been “basically cleared,” with excess bubble after a 50% pullback
After falling from the $126,000 peak, major institutions view the current level as a healthy shakeout【mkt】
• The U.S. SEC proposes a new crypto rules framework in the absence of the CLARITY Act
Regulators proactively fill the gap, covering three major areas: trading, custody, and disclosure【pol】
• The U.S. Financial Accounting Standards Board (FASB) plans to allow stablecoins to be classified as cash equivalents
Once implemented, companies’ financial reports may treat compliant stablecoins as cash【pol】
• MAYAChain paused the network due to a $1.7 million vulnerability, with 20 BTC already moved out
Another cross-chain bridge security incident; markets continue to watch persistent DeFi bridge risks【sec】
• Ripple raised $275 million betting on U.S. wholesale brokerage business, targeting institutional demand
With expectations of regulatory clarity, traditional capital channels have become the focus of the next round of competition【hot】
